Specs: Nagant M1895 Revolver
The Nagant M1895 is a solid-frame, seven-shot revolver chambered for the proprietary 7.62x38mmR cartridge. The gas-seal system is what makes this gun mechanically distinctive in comparison with every other manufacturing revolver. Because the hammer is cocked, a cam system pushed by the set off strikes the cylinder ahead in order that the mouth of the cartridge seats contained in the forcing cone on the rear of the barrel. The bullet is seated totally throughout the cartridge case, and when fired the brass expands and seals that junction fully. The result’s that no propellant fuel escapes the cylinder hole as a result of there successfully is not any cylinder hole in the mean time of firing. That is additionally what makes the double-action set off pull so punishing, since you aren’t solely cocking the hammer and rotating the cylinder but in addition bodily driving it ahead in opposition to a spring. Official specs listing a double-action pull at round 20 kilos. From what I’ve skilled and browse, that quantity may be optimistic relying on the person gun, particularly wartime and refurbished examples. Single-action pull runs round 12 kilos. Neither is what anybody would name nice, however the single-action is no less than manageable.
- Years Produced: 1895 to 1945, with some post-war meeting from remaining elements
- Quantity Manufactured: Roughly 2.6 million
- Caliber: 7.62x38mmR (also referred to as 7.62mm Nagant or Cartridge Sort R)
- Capability: 7 rounds
- Motion: Double-action/single-action (officer mannequin), single-action solely (soldier mannequin)
- Barrel Size: 4.5 inches
- Total Size: 9.4 inches
- Weight: 1 pound 12 ounces unloaded
- Set off Pull: Roughly 12 lbs single-action, 20+ lbs double-action
- Sights: Mounted entrance blade, rear notch
- End: Blued
- Grips: Checkered walnut on authentic examples, Bakelite on most refurbished weapons
- Security: None

Ammunition is its personal dialog. The 7.62x38mmR is a proprietary cartridge that you’re not discovering at your native store. Fiocchi and Privi Partizan each produce business loadings, and they’re obtainable on-line, although priced increased than you’d count on for a .30 caliber revolver spherical. The business stuff additionally runs noticeably slower than real navy surplus hundreds. Surplus ammo does nonetheless flip up from time to time and in case you discover it at a good value it’s value grabbing. Reloading is an possibility utilizing .32-20 Winchester brass with the Lee Nagant die set, which might be probably the most sensible long-term answer for anybody planning to shoot these often. The .32 ACP Conversion Cylinder: Nagant M1895 Revolver
That is one thing a whole lot of Nagant house owners ultimately look into, and I’ve firsthand expertise with it, so I may give you an trustworthy take. Aftermarket cylinders can be found that permit the Nagant to fireplace .32 ACP as an alternative of the proprietary 7.62x38mmR. The attraction is clear since .32 ACP is infinitely extra obtainable and cheaper. I discovered mine on eBay, which appears to be the first market for these.
Word: Early on of their importation, 32 S&W cylinders had been made, however I’ve heard combined evaluations on them, and so they aren’t straightforward to get ahold of, which can inform the story.

Right here is the disclaimer it’s essential to hear earlier than you order one: There’s a very actual likelihood it is not going to suit your gun with out work. I purchased one for myself and one for former AllOutdoor Editor Adam S., and neither cylinder match both of our weapons out of the field. I ended up taking them to a gunsmith to have a couple of surfaces match earlier than they’d perform. This isn’t a drop-in half. The explanation it’s trickier than a typical cylinder swap is that the Nagant cylinder doesn’t simply rotate; it additionally strikes ahead and rearward as a part of the gas-seal mechanism. Getting that timing and match proper takes some hands-on consideration. It’s doable, however go in understanding it could price you a gunsmith go to on prime of the acquisition value.

As soon as fitted, I’ve not had any issues taking pictures .32 ACP by means of mine, and I’ve not heard of others having points both. That mentioned, that is buy-at-your-own-risk territory, and I need to be upfront about that. I’ll have extra to say about the way it truly shoots in Half IV. One factor value noting is that swapping to the .32 ACP cylinder eliminates the gas-seal perform totally since that cartridge doesn’t work together with the forcing cone the best way the 7.62x38mmR does. Threading and Suppressing the Nagant M1895 Revolver
With suppressors turning into more and more common and the tax stamp at the moment sitting at zero {dollars}, threading a Nagant for a can has turn out to be one thing a whole lot of house owners are wanting into. The gas-seal design makes this one of many only a few revolvers in existence that may be meaningfully suppressed, and the outcomes are genuinely spectacular.

Taking pictures the Nagant suppressed with the unique 7.62x38mmR military-spec ammunition is one thing else. As a result of the gas-seal system eliminates the cylinder hole totally, there’s nowhere for fuel to flee besides down the barrel and into the suppressor. The result’s about as quiet as a suppressed .22 LR. That’s not an exaggeration. It’s a remarkably quiet setup, and the fuel seal is the rationale why most revolvers can’t be successfully suppressed within the first place.

The .32 ACP conversion cylinder modifications that image considerably. With out the gas-seal cartridge doing its job, you will have a normal revolver cylinder hole, and fuel bleeds on the market freely identical to every other wheel gun. The suppressor nonetheless reduces the muzzle report, however you lose the majority of the profit. It’s noticeably louder than the unique cartridge suppressed. I might name it listening to protected personally, although my listening to has seen higher days. It’s not a full, unsuppressed gunshot sound, nevertheless it has sufficient pop that it’s best to suppose twice earlier than skipping ear safety.
